On the other hand, if y and z depend on x (are dependent variables) then the notation represents a function of the single independent variable x. … WebFor example, in the below algebraic equation. y = 4x + 3. You will notice that the value of the 'y' variable is dependent on the variations in the value of 'x'. Therefore, the variable 'y' is a dependent variable. The variable 'x' is an independent variable. 2. …

WebTypes of Variables. In math, a variable is a symbol (usually a letter) we use to represent a number whose value we don't know yet.. Two important types of variables in all types of math and science (shout-out to the science-lovers!) are independent variables (IV) and dependent variables (DV).. As with many math terms, there are several names for each … WebA symbol that stands for an arbitrary input is called an independent variable, while a symbol that stands for an arbitrary output is called a dependent variable.[6] The most common symbol for the input is x, and the most common symbol for the output is y; the function itself is commonly written y= f(x). WebAn "input" value of a function. Example: y = x2. • x is an Independent Variable. • y is the Dependent Variable. Example: h = 2w + d. • w is an Independent Variable.
